Evans (1971) has reported that voids produced by irradiation could form into three-dimensional arrays. Since then void lattices have been observed in a number of metals, for example, Mo, W, Nb, Ta, Al and Ni. In all these metals the pattern of ordering shows many similarities. The infrared cut-off of glasses is primarily determined by the frequency of vibration of the cation-anion bonds. In order to extend infrared transmittance to longer wavelengths cations and anions of larger sizes and lower field strengths should be used; however, physical and chemical properties become poorer.
